To keep a boom truck in optimal condition, systematic upkeep is essential. Routine checks should cover hoisting systems, pulleys, and hooks for any signs of wear. Hydraulic systems must be flushed and refilled periodically to prevent contamination. Operators should clean external components after use to reduce dust accumulation. Electrical control panels require testing to confirm accurate response times. Regular greasing of joints and bearings improves efficiency and reduces energy consumption. Environmental protection measures, like storing the crane in covered areas, extend service life. With careful attention, a boom truck delivers consistent results.

Q: What type of crane is best for high-rise construction?
A: Tower cranes are the best choice for high-rise construction due to their height and lifting capabilities.
Q: Are mobile cranes suitable for urban construction sites?
A: Yes, mobile cranes are compact and easy to maneuver, making them ideal for urban construction.
Q: Can your cranes operate in extreme weather conditions?
A: Many models are designed to withstand harsh weather, but specific conditions may require additional precautions.
Q: How often should cranes undergo maintenance?
A: Regular maintenance is essential. We recommend following the manufacturer’s schedule and conducting periodic inspections.
